#2a3056 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a3056 is composed of 16.5% red, 18.8%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 231.8 degrees, a saturation of 34.4% and a lightness of 25.1%. #2a3056 color hex could be obtained by blending #5460ac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#2a3056 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#2a3056 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a3056 has RGB values of R:42, G:48,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 2764886.
